Actor and comedian Kevin Hart was arrested early Sunday morning (April 14) on suspicion of DUI after he nearly slammed into a gas tanker while speeding on a freeway, according to the celeb-site TMZ.
The CHP told TMZ that officers spotted Hart driving a black Mercedes on the 101 Freeway at around 4:30 a.m. Sunday. The CHP said he was “driving erratically,” “going 90 miles per hour,” and that he “almost collided with a gas tanker truck.”
Hart, who hosted Saturday Night Live a few weeks ago, showed “objective signs of intoxication” and was “unable to perform field sobriety tests” at the side of the road, according to law enforcement officials.
Hart was taken to a local jail for misdemeanor DUI and posted a $5,000 bond.
TMZ further reports that on his way out of jail Sunday morning, Hart admitted to TMZ that he was intoxicated when he was stopped by the CHP, and told officers he had been drinking.
